    Quote Originally Posted by bobh4656 View Post
    The sad part is this principal has bought into the myth that candy canes were shaped like a J to represent J for Jesus. However that's only a myth with no relationship to the truth. The original candy canes were sticks and just straight and white. Over time They morphed into a J when candy started being hung on Christmas trees. The J is handy for that task. So we have yet another uneducated educator spoiling the education system. Go figure.
    This is what I thought the hook was for also.

    Quote Originally Posted by Bassman Ia. View Post
    The problem---

    Bibles are allowed in prisons------
    Bibles are not allowed in schools--
    This is because we allow inmates to choose and practice their religion and make all reasonable accomodations for them to do so. Indian sweat lodges, Islam, Hindu, Christianity, Wicken and a hundred others. No inmate or staff is allowed to disrupt any of them. At my last workplace every year on Christmas day a local Church group of at least 200 people come and sing Christmas songs and pray. They bring a brown bag of candy, cookies, a card made by the children, and a small Bible, a few colors and pens and pencils, and writing paper with envelopes. Not one single inmate refuses the "presents" given in Jesus name. Granted some will give the Bible away and not participate in the prayer part or Christmas songs but they ALL take the gift and ALL thank the members and are very respectful. Never an incident in over 20 years of this. The Deputy Director of the institution works all religious Holidays as his family does not celebrate religious holidays, they are just another work day for him and he doesn't have to work them but does. People just need to be tolerant of ALL others when it comes to beliefs, the inmates i spoke of set a great example of that on any religious holidays for any group. Do they do the same once they are out, I don't know.
